Arburg Views Multi-Component Molding as a Core Expertise. He Said the Company Has Been Involved in Multi-Component Parts Since 1962.
Modular Machine Technology Alows for Individual Customer-Specific Solutions, Wender Said.
Brian Hartlmeier, Program Manager in Elm Grove, WIS., With the Mgs Automation Division, Discussed the Variable Considerations in Creating Tools for Multi-Shot Molded PARTS.
Hartlmeier Said more applications are incorpoating soft-time tpe overmolding beyond the state grip, handle and surface embellishment uses.
He recoming the user of higher tempicting materials in the substation molding step and cooler tests on the overmolding step.
"Clear Parts Bring AdDitional Concerns," He Added.
Hartlmeier Encourant Product DEVELOPERS to go to the Experts in Materials and Plastics Processing Machines and COWORKERS BeFore Moving A Project to Far Down the Line.
